Ok guys so ive stripped my airsoft m870 down to use as a gl. Ive got as far as the trigger assembly and now im stuck.
What do i do with the safety and unloader button? And im guessing the trigger guard needs cutting off?

I did ask in the airsoft section but nobody has replyed and im guessing it would be a very similar process for all shotguns. Can anyone can help because ive come to a standstill

IIRC trigger guard and safety are cut off - but the front part of the guard must not be cut too short as there is a spring inside.

Author:  bigbisont [ Mon Sep 26, 2016 2:48 pm ]
Post subject: 

don't mess with the unloader button. You will want to keep that.

Trigger guard def needs to be cut off and Crash is 100% correct, you gotta leave some space to account for the both the safety and the spring for the hammer.
I cut mine too short. It wasn't bad and I was able to recover, but it is best to avoid doing what I did.
